Overview
We are seeking a motivated Junior Software Developer to join our development team. The ideal candidate has hands-on experience supporting code releases, working with Microsoft development technologies, and developing applications using JavaScript and C#. This role is well suited for someone who is eager to grow their technical skills, collaborate with experienced developers, and contribute to the full software development lifecycle.
Responsibilities- Assist in the design, development, testing, and maintenance of software applications.
- Participate in code deployments and release management activities across development, staging, and production environments.
- Develop and maintain applications using Microsoft technologies including C#, .NET, and related frameworks.
- Write and maintain front-end functionality using JavaScript, HTML, and CSS.
- Troubleshoot and resolve software defects and performance issues.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ams including QA, Dev Ops, product owners, and senior developers.
- Participate in code reviews and follow established coding standards and best practices.
- Document technical processes, configurations, and development procedures.
- Continuously learn new tools, technologies, and development methodologies.
